An 82-year-old enrolled in college classes after her husband died, and inspired her fellow students so much that they voted her Homecoming Queen.

Frances Wood enrolled at Mid-America Nazarene University in Kansas, to take classes in finance, history and literature after her husband of 59 years passed.

“I was beginning to get just a little lonely and depressed,” the grandmother told KCTV. “I needed something different to do and, believe me, this is different.”
